An established outpatient practice in Virginia's Shenandoah Valley is immediately hiring a new Pain Management Physician Assistant or Nurse Practitioner. The new APP must be comfortable prescribing controlled substances and performing intrathecal pump refills, no injections or procedures. Experience in pain management, internal medicine, neurology, and/or orthopedics is highly preferred.

The office is open weekdays, with no weekend or call requirements. This is a full-time permanent position with bonus opportunity, medical benefits, 401K with match, CME, PTO, tuition assistance, and malpractice.
